How many cars are there in Stratford-on-Avon?

There were 90,335 licensed cars in Stratford-on-Avon at the end of March 2026, and 111,473 licensed vehicles of all kinds. That is 22.8% more cars than in 2010. Privately kept cars work out at 586 for every 1,000 residents, 11th highest of 361 councils (UK 441).

Petrol, diesel and electric cars in Stratford-on-Avon

56.0% of cars in Stratford-on-Avon run on petrol and 29.4% on diesel. Diesel’s share peaked at 40.0% in 2017. Hybrids that do not plug in make up 7.3%, and cars that plug in 6.8%.

Electric cars in Stratford-on-Avon

3,986 battery electric cars were licensed in Stratford-on-Avon at the end of March 2026, 4.4% of all cars, 69th highest of 361 councils. With plug-in hybrids, 6,171 cars plug in. A year earlier there were 2,927.

Of the privately kept cars, which are registered at home addresses, 3.7% are battery electric (3,197 cars), 4th highest of 30 councils in the West Midlands. Companies keep 19.8% of the area’s battery electric cars, against 5.1% of its cars overall. There are also 61 battery electric vans.

Public EV chargers in Stratford-on-Avon

There were 293 public chargers in Stratford-on-Avon on 1 July 2026, 107 of them rapid or ultra-rapid (50kW and above). That is 200 for every 100,000 residents, 86th highest of 361 councils, against 175 across the UK. The count fell 1.0% from 1 January 2026.

For every public charger there are 16.2 privately kept plug-in cars in Stratford-on-Avon (UK 11.9), 176th most of 361 councils. A higher number means more competition for each public charger, though many drivers charge at home.

Electric cars by neighbourhood

Stratford-on-Avon has 15 ONS neighbourhoods (middle layer super output areas, about 7,000 residents each). In the typical one, 3.4% of privately kept vehicles are battery electric; in the highest, 4.7%. ONS names neighbourhoods by council and number, not by place name.

Petrol and diesel prices in Stratford-on-Avon

Unleaded petrol averages 174.3p a litre across 25 filling stations in Stratford-on-Avon, 2.6p above the UK average. Diesel averages 197.4p, 2.8p above the UK average. Prices checked 16 Sept, 16:47.

  • Coverage: licensing and charger figures cover the whole UK. Licensing figures in Stratford-on-Avon run from the end of 2009.
  • Vehicles are counted at the registered keeper’s postcode: for company cars that is the company’s address, not where the car is driven.
  • Battery electric and plug-in counts come from table VEH0142; petrol, diesel and hybrid counts from VEH0105. “Other fuels” is VEH0105’s other-fuel count less plug-in cars.
  • Charger counts are based on Zapmap data and are official statistics in development. In June 2026 one operator removed about 1,270 private chargers wrongly listed as public, so April and July are not strictly comparable.
  • Neighbourhood figures cover England and Wales only; Scottish data zones and Northern Irish super data zones cannot be placed in councils without lookups we do not hold.
